CVE-2025-10622

HIGHCVSS 8/10EPSS 0.52%

Last modified

CVE-2025-10622 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 8/10 on the CVSS scale. A flaw was found in Red Hat Satellite (Foreman component). This vulnerability allows an authenticated user with edit_settings permissions to achieve arbitrary command execution on the underlying operating system via insufficient server-side validation of command whitelisting.. EPSS estimates a 0.52%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
